데이터 수집 구성 요소

데이터 수집 구성 요소에는 데이터 수집 서버, DIL API, 인바운드 서버 간 데이터 전송 및 로그 파일이 포함됩니다.

Audience Manager에는 다음 데이터 수집 구성 요소가 포함되어 있습니다.

DCS(데이터 수집 서버) 및 PCS(프로필 캐시 서버)

DCS와 PCS는 함께 작동하며 트레이트 실현, 대상 세그멘테이션 및 데이터 저장과 관련된 서비스를 별도로 제공합니다.

Data Collection Servers (DCS)함수로 플러그인 호출

Audience Manager에서 DCS는

  • 이벤트 호출에서 트레이트 데이터를 수신하고 평가합니다. 여기에는 실시간 세그먼테이션에 사용되는 정보와 서버 간 전송에 의해 예약된 간격으로 전달된 데이터가 포함됩니다.
  • 구현된 트레이트 및 세그먼트 빌더로 만든 자격 규칙을 기반으로 사용자를 세그먼트화합니다.
  • 장치 ID 및 인증된 프로필 ID를 만들고 관리합니다. 여기에는 데이터 공급자 ID, 사용자 ID, 선언된 ID, 통합 코드 등과 같은 식별자가 포함됩니다.
  • 실시간 이벤트 호출 전에 사용자가 이미 구현한 추가 트레이트가 있는지 PCS에서 확인합니다. 이를 통해 DCS는 실시간 데이터 및 이전 데이터를 기반으로 사용자를 평가할 수 있습니다.
  • 로그 파일을 작성하여 스토리지 및 처리를 위해 분석 시스템으로 전송합니다.

DCS수요 관리Global Server Load Balancing (GSLB)

DCS은 지리적으로 분산된 부하 분산 시스템입니다. 즉, Audience Manager은(는) 사이트 방문자의 지리적 위치를 기반으로 지역 데이터 센터에 대한 요청을 직접 보낼 수 있습니다. 이 전략은 DCS 응답이 해당 방문자에 대한 정보가 포함된 데이터 센터로 직접 이동하므로 응답 시간을 개선하는 데 도움이 됩니다. GSLB 는 사용자에게 가장 가까운 서버에서 관련 데이터를 캐시하므로 시스템을 효율적으로 만듭니다.

중요

DCS은 IPv4를 사용하는 장치에서 시작된 웹 트래픽만 감지합니다.

이벤트 호출에서 지리적 위치는 더 큰 JSON 데이터 본문에서 반환된 키-값 쌍에 캡처됩니다. 이 키-값 쌍은 "dcs_region": region ID 매개 변수입니다.

고객은 데이터 수집 코드를 통해 DCS에 간접적으로 참여합니다. API 세트를 통해 DCS에서 직접 작업할 수도 있습니다. DCS(데이터 수집 서버) API 메서드 및 코드를 참조하십시오.

Profile Cache Servers (PCS)

PCS은(는) 큰 데이터베이스(기본적으로 대형 서버측 쿠키)입니다. 서버 간 전송 및 DCS에서 활성 사용자에 대해 받은 데이터를 저장합니다. PCS 데이터는 장치 ID, 인증된 프로필 ID 및 연결된 트레이트로 구성됩니다. DCS이 실시간 호출을 받으면 사용자가 속하거나 자격이 있는 다른 트레이트가 있는지 PCS에서 확인합니다. 또한, 나중에 트레이트가 세그먼트에 추가되는 경우 해당 트레이트 ID가 PCS에 추가되고 사용자는 특정 사이트나 앱을 방문하지 않고도 자동으로 해당 세그먼트에 대한 자격을 얻을 수 있습니다. PCS은(는) 새롭고 역사적인 트레이트 데이터를 사용하여 실시간으로 또는 백그라운드에서 사용자를 일치시키고 세그먼트화할 수 있으므로 Audience Manager에 대한 사용자의 이해를 깊게 하는 데 도움이 됩니다. 이 동작은 실시간 자격 조건에서만 사용하는 것보다 사용자를 더 완전하고 정확하게 파악할 수 있도록 합니다.

고객이 PCS 을 사용하여 직접 작업할 수 있는 UI 컨트롤이 없습니다. PCS에 대한 고객 액세스는 데이터 저장소 및 데이터 전송의 역할을 통해 간접적으로 수행됩니다. PCS은 Apache Cassandra에서 실행됩니다.

에서 비활성 ID 삭제PCS

앞에서 설명한 대로 PCS은 활성 사용자에 대한 트레이트 ID를 저장합니다. 활성 사용자는 지난 14일 동안 모든 도메인에서 Edge Data Server에 의해 본 모든 사용자입니다. 이러한 호출은 PCS 사용자를 활성 상태로 유지합니다.

  • /event 호출
  • /ibs 호출(ID 동기화)

PCS 은 17일 동안 비활성 상태인 경우 트레이트를 플러시합니다. 하지만 이러한 트레이트는 잃지 않습니다. hadoop에 저장됩니다. 사용자가 다른 시간에 다시 표시되면 Hadoop은 모든 트레이트를 PCS (일반적으로 24시간 기간 내)으로 푸시합니다.

기타 DCS/PCS 프로세스:개인 정보 옵트아웃

이러한 서버 시스템은 개인 정보 보호 및 사용자 옵트아웃 요청을 처리합니다. 사용자가 데이터 수집을 옵트아웃한 경우 사용자 쿠키 정보는 로그 파일에 수집되지 않습니다. 개인 정보 보호 정책에 대한 자세한 내용은 Adobe 개인 정보 보호 센터를 참조하십시오.

DIL(데이터 통합 라이브러리)

DIL 는 데이터 수집을 위해 페이지에 배치하는 코드입니다. 사용 가능한 서비스 및 메서드에 대한 자세한 내용은 DIL API 를 참조하십시오.

인바운드 서버 간

이러한 시스템은 Adobe 클라이언트와의 다양한 서버 간 통합에서 전송한 데이터를 수신하는 시스템입니다. 자세한 내용은 대상 데이터 보내기의 설명서를 참조하십시오.

로그 파일

PCS은 로그 파일에 데이터를 만들고 기록합니다. 처리, 보고 및 저장을 위해 다른 데이터베이스 시스템으로 전송됩니다.

이 페이지에서는